While the days of presenting an offer in person have passed, we cannot discount the impact that personal details about our clients can have on a seller.
I am currently working on a transaction that had multiple offers. While talking to the listing agent I mentioned that my buyer really liked the landscaping and that she has always enjoyed gardening. The listing agent later called me to tell me that the seller takes a lot of pride in her yard, and knowing that my buyer would appreciate the property the way she did made a big difference.
My buyer is now on her way to owning the home that she loves, and the seller feels good knowing that the new owner appreciates her hard work and will enjoy the outdoor space the way she did.
This was a helpful reminder that while it is an "arm's length transaction" there are bodies attached to those arms. The buyers and sellers, are more than what we see on paper, and a cover letter about the client sometimes sells the deal.
